How Jayson Werth's Walks Compares to Similar Players
Jayson Werth totaled 764 career Walks, well above the league average of 164.7 — a mark that ranked among the best of his era. His best Walks season came in 2009, posting 91, well above the league average of 21.7 that year. The lowest point came in 2003 at 3, well below the league average of 20.1 that year.
